WebApr 8, 2024 · Linear Polarization- Linearly polarized light wave means that the electric field vibrates in a certain linear direction perpendicular to the wave axis, and the magnetic field vibrates in a direction that is perpendicular to both, the advancement axis and direction of the electric field. WebJul 1, 2024 · A linear polarized light is a wave with the electric field vector, E, oscillating along a given direction, perpendicular to the propagation direction (sometimes, this kind of polarization is called plane polarization, the plane of polarization being the plane defined by the direction of the electric field and the direction of propagation).
